When I transitioned from the investment industry to working at a central bank, I realised that there was a distinct “language of central banking” that I needed to grasp quickly. The Global Central Banking and Financial Regulation qualifications at Warwick Business School (WBS) offered the perfect opportunity to bridge that gap, as the curriculum was highly relevant to my day- to-day work. The bursary, along with support from my employer, who strongly values employee development, made it possible for me to seize this opportunity. Without this crucial financial support, I would not have been able to enrol in the programme and enhance my knowledge in such a meaningful way. One of the best aspects of the programme was the ability to access the expertise and insights of experienced lecturers while studying from the other side of the world. This format allowed me to avoid the significant time and financial costs associated with international travel. It allowed me to maintain my work-life balance while continuing my education. The programme has already had a direct impact on my career, enabling me to engage more confidently and meaningfully in technical conversations at work. I would highly recommend this programme to any student, particularly those from emerging markets like myself. If you’re a relatively new employee of a central bank, this course is an excellent way to accelerate your learning.” Naweed Hoosenmia Global Central Banking and Financial Regulation qualifications participant
